  • Applications

    2-Hydroxy-3-Methoxybenzaldehyde, CAS 148-53-8, is primarily used as an aromatic intermediate in fragrance and flavor chemistry, enabling the synthesis of related substituted benzaldehydes and serving as an odorant component in perfumery; it is commonly evaluated as a fragrance ingredient for cosmetics and personal care products, and may be used as a building block in the industrial production of more complex aromatic compounds. Additionally, it can function as a synthesis precursor for aroma substances employed in household cleaners and other consumer goods, and may appear as a reactive intermediate in coatings and inks formulations.
